i have an old 1970"s mtd splitter and the ram goes out real slow and no power at all.i put a new 11gal. 2/stage on it and no difference at all.when the ram goes out it is real spongy,you can kinda push it back alittle and it kinda springs back & then continues forward very slowly the stops when it hits the wood.ther is no way to check the fluid(30wt HD oil) in the cylander.only a little weep hole plug at end of cylander.when i opened it real foamy oil did come out.can you help me...pleaaase.....Dj

Welcome. Perhaps post this in another forum such as rural living and you will get more replies. I'm not a hydraulic expert but you probably need to replace the fluid as it sounds like you have air in there and or not enough fluid.

Make sure there is fluid in the reservoir and the suction line from the reservoir to the pump is clear.

You really need to put a pressure guage on it to see what kind of PSI you are developing. That will do wonders when trying to diagnose hydraulics:thumbsup:

I am betting the seals on the piston inside the cylinder are bad, and they are bypassing fluid...it needs to be rebuilt.
